A SEAT BELT WITH DAMAGE CAN CAUSE SERIOUS PERSONAL
INJURY. EXAMINE THE SEAT BELT SYSTEM DAILY. REPLACE
PARTS WITH DAMAGE IMMEDIATELY. SPEAK WITH YOUR LOCAL
DEALER OR DISTRIBUTOR FOR REPAIR. A SEAT BELT THAT DOES
NOT OPERATE CORRECTLY CAN CAUSE PERSONAL INJURY.
Repair or replace a seat belt that does not operate correctly or is not in good condition immediately.
Have your seat belts inspected by a dealer/distributor after any accident. A damaged seat belt may not
give as much protection in a subsequent accident.
Seat Belt Inspection:
1.
Extend fully each belt.
2.
Inspect the seat belt before each use. Visually look for cuts, fraying, and loose parts. Damaged
parts must be replaced immediately.
CORRECT SEAT BELT POSITION
WARNING
MAKE SURE THAT THE SHOULDER BELT IS POSITIONED ACROSS
THE CENTER OF THE SHOULDER. THE BELT SHOULD BE KEPT
AWAY FROM THE NECK, BUT NOT FALLING OFF THE SHOULDER.
FAILURE TO DO SO CAN REDUCE THE AMOUNT OF PROTECTION
AND INCREASE THE CHANCE OF INJURY.
Proper Seat Belt Position
• Sit up straight and well back in the seat.
• Always keep your feet on the floor in front of you.
• Always use the correct buckle for your seating position.
• Position the lap belt as low as possible on the hips and not the waist. Make sure that the belt is
not twisted.
• Position the shoulder belt across the center of the shoulder. The belt should be kept away from
the neck, but not falling off the shoulder. Make sure that the belt is not twisted.
• Wear the shoulder belt over the shoulder and across the chest. These parts of the body are best
able to take belt restraining forces. The shoulder belt locks if there is a sudden stop or crash.
• Younger children and infants that require a safety seat or that can benefit from the protection of
a safety seat must not be an occupant of this vehicle. This vehicle is not designed to meet child
safety seat compatibility requirements.
• Comply with all state and local laws pertaining to child safety.
• Pregnant Women - Consult your doctor for specific recommendations. The seat belt must be
worn securely and as low as possible over the hips and not on the waist
• Injured Persons - Consult your doctor for specific recommendations.
• Seat Belt Extenders - Club Car does not recommend the use of seat belt extenders.
